SUMMARY: Responsible for greeting customers, checking identification, collecting admissions charges and controlling the flow of traffic; and maintaining Guest areas by performing the following duties:


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ned.

M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ES

Greets guests with a smile in a professional, friendly and courteous manner. Provides information and conversation while guests are waiting in queue. Says “hello and goodbye – type” comments to every guest entering/exiting through our doors. Handles initial contact with VIP customers and guests with special needs.

Checks identification and makes sure that patrons are of legal age when applicable.

Collects admission charges or entertainment fees upon entry.

Communicates effectively with all guests, co-workers and management.

Occasionally answers telephone calls and related questions.

Notifies manager/supervisor of low inventory and recommends new inventory and communicates opportunities/concerns/situations.

Maintains cleanliness around the front/facade of the building and guest restrooms. Keeps venue clean and free of litter at all times.

Assists management in training new staff members within their department when applicable.

Demonstrates core values of company every shift.

Maintains high-level of knowledge regarding the company’s products and happenings and ability to communicate properly to guests. Establishes rapport with all guests through name recognition.

Performs other duties and tasks as assigned or determined by management or supervisors.

Completes all opening, running and closing duties as assigned.

Enforces responsible alcohol management.

Understands and utilizes all safety and sanitation practices as defined in the safety program and reports any accidents to management.

Adheres to all company policies and procedures as established in the Staff Member Handbook.

COMPLEXITY OF WORK: Generally routine; established precedents; practices and procedures exist.

RELATIONSHIPS OUTSIDE WORK UNIT: Exchange of information, which frequently requires tact and/or diplomacy.

S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ES: N/A

QUALIFICATIONS: To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. Must be 18 years of age or older.

REGULAR ATTENDANCE is required and expected.

EDUCATION and/or EXPERIENCE: High school degree or GED preferred. One year customer service experience preferred; previous experience in a food and beverage environment helpful; One to two years work experience in a security capacity; or equivalent combination of education and experience.

CERTIFICATES, LICENCES, REGISTRATIONS: Health permit/food safety and TAM cards. Staff member is required to obtain cards individually and provide proof of possession prior to first day of employment.

ON-THE-JOB TRAINING: Four days learning company policies and procedures and other required and necessary information.
